原文:Maven打包同一個jar有不同的:版本+時間戳(解決思路)

在我們的開發過程中,目前流行的版本控制工具maven,在項目開發階段,大家都是通過發布SNAPSHOT快照版進行相互模塊之間的依賴開發, 這個時候就會有一個問題,要是一天構建多次的快照版,會發現在項目打包的時候,WEB INF下的lib文件夾有很多重名的jar,只是加了時間戳,如下圖所示: 本文提供一種方式解決去除重包的問題。 在需要打包的war的pom文件下,添加以下配置: 將相關的finalN ...

2018-06-08 11:06 1 3824 推薦指數:

查看詳情

系統優化(一)Maven打包同一個jar有不同的:版本號+時間戳(解決思路)

解決maven倉庫的ear里面有非常多個同樣的jar(僅僅是包括不同的:版本號+時間戳) 問題描寫敘述: 發現ear里面有非常多個同樣的jar,僅僅是包括不同的:版本號+時間戳,例如以下圖所看到的: (比如:itoo-basic-api有非常多同樣的jar,僅僅是包括不同的:版本 ...

Sun Jul 16 16:46:00 CST 2017 0 9307
解決Maven重復依賴問題(同一個jar,多個版本

問題描述 現在開發項目,一般都會創建maven工程,用它來管理依賴實在是方便了,當然它還有其它用途。但是在實際的情況中往往會有重復依賴的問題,比如創建的工程A,依賴了b-1.0.jar,而b-1.0.jar又依賴了d-1.0.jar(這個我們本身是不能直接看到的),同時我們自己的工程又依賴 ...

Tue Jan 19 00:28:00 CST 2021 0 3081
maven打包時間戳

基於Maven的項目,發布時需要打包,如tar.gz。web項目打成war格式包。每次打包時希望自己加上時間戳,假如我的項目名是myproject,默認打包后名為myproject.war。而我希望的名字為myproject-1.0.0-20160217。方便以后對包進行查找與管理,如何實現這種 ...

Thu Feb 01 20:40:00 CST 2018 0 4531
maven版本中帶時間戳

版本中加上時間戳 時間戳的時區問題 https://juejin.cn/post/7011877028848910344 手里的任務就是要將Maven打的包設置成xxx-2021209252204.jar,因為是springboot項目,網上的例子其實有很多。 開始時使用了maven自帶 ...

Sat Nov 20 02:03:00 CST 2021 0 875
maven 版本發布添加上時間戳

使用插件添加時間戳 我使用的是spring boot - 2.0.3.RELEASE版本 pom中加入 <!-- 加入這個 就可以直接在配置文件中取到時間戳了,注意: 由於${}方式會被maven處理。 如果你pom繼承了spring-boot-starter-parent ...

Thu Jan 03 03:51:00 CST 2019 0 732
maven打包時間戳方法總結

基於Maven的項目,發布時需要打包,如tar.gz。web項目打成war格式包。每次打包時希望自己加上時間戳,假如我的項目名是myproject,默認打包后名為myproject.war。而我希望的名字為myproject-1.0.0-20160217。方便以后對包進行查找與管理,如何實現這種 ...

Wed Jun 21 17:58:00 CST 2017 0 3184
Maven把項目依賴的所有jar包都打到同一個jar

目錄 1 使用maven-shade-plugin 2 推薦: 使用maven-assembly-plugin 3 擴展: Maven安裝本地jar包到本地倉庫 4 擴展: 手動生成jar包 5 擴展: Linux下運行jar包的幾種方式 ...

Fri Feb 22 02:24:00 CST 2019 0 3153
Java9系列第三篇-同一個Jar支持多JDK版本運行

我計划在后續的一段時間內,寫一系列關於java 9的文章,雖然java 9 不像Java 8或者Java 11那樣的核心java版本,但是還是有很多的特性值得關注。期待您能關注我,我將把java 9 寫成一系列的文章,大概十篇左右。 java9第一篇-可以在interface中定義私有 ...

Fri Oct 16 16:07:00 CST 2020 0 612
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M